Auf eine Datenquellenspalte zugreifen und sie ändern
Verwenden Sie diese Klasse nur mit Daten, die mit einer Datenbank verbunden sind.
Methoden
| Methode | Rückgabetyp | Kurzbeschreibung |
|---|---|---|
get | Data | Ruft die Datenquelle ab, die mit der Datenquellenspalte verknüpft ist. |
get | String | Ruft die Formel für die Datenquellenspalte ab. |
get | String | Ruft den Namen für die Datenquellenspalte ab. |
has | Boolean | Gibt zurück, ob die Spalte eine Arrayabhängigkeit hat. |
is | Boolean | Gibt zurück, ob die Spalte eine berechnete Spalte ist. |
remove() | void | Entfernt die Datenquellenspalte. |
set | Data | Legt die Formel für die Datenquellenspalte fest. |
set | Data | Legt den Namen der Datenquellenspalte fest. |
Detaillierte Dokumentation
getDataSource()
Ruft die Datenquelle ab, die mit der Datenquellenspalte verknüpft ist.
Rückgabe
DataSource : Die Datenquelle.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
getFormula()
Ruft die Formel für die Datenquellenspalte ab. Gibt einen leeren String zurück, wenn die Datenquellenspalte
keine calculated column ist.
Rückgabe
String : Die Formel.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
getName()
Ruft den Namen für die Datenquellenspalte ab.
Rückgabe
String : Der Spaltenname.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
hasArrayDependency()
Gibt zurück, ob die Spalte eine Arrayabhängigkeit hat.
Rückgabe
Boolean : true, wenn die Spalte eine Arrayabhängigkeit hat, andernfalls false.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
isCalculatedColumn()
Gibt zurück, ob die Spalte eine berechnete Spalte ist.
Rückgabe
Boolean : true, wenn die Spalte eine berechnete Spalte ist, andernfalls false.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
remove()
Entfernt die Datenquellenspalte.
Wird nur für calculated columns unterstützt.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
setFormula(formula)
Legt die Formel für die Datenquellenspalte fest.
Wird nur für calculated columns unterstützt.
Parameter
| Name | Typ | Beschreibung |
|---|---|---|
formula | String | Die neue Formel. |
Rückgabe
DataSourceColumn : Die Datenquellenspalte für die Verkettung.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ets
setName(name)
Legt den Namen der Datenquellenspalte fest.
Wird nur für calculated columns unterstützt.
Parameter
| Name | Typ | Beschreibung |
|---|---|---|
name | String | Der festzulegende Name. |
Rückgabe
DataSourceColumn : Die Datenquellenspalte für die Verkettung.
Autorisierung
Scripts, die diese Methode verwenden, benötigen eine Autorisierung für mindestens einen der folgenden Zugriffsbereiche:
-
https://www.googleapis.com/auth/spreadsheets.currentonly -
https://www.googleapis.com/auth/spreadsheets